Canadian Firm Planning Calais Call Center

November 14 2007

Toronto-based Acrobat Research plans to expand with the opening of a call center in Calais, Maine and the recruitment of more than 80 full-time and 130 part-time staff in January.

The firm already operates call centres in Ontario and Nova Scotia (www.mrweb.com/drno/news7255.htm ), but this will be its first in the US.

'Calais fits our business model of operations in rural areas and, we believe, provides a great location for our first site in the States,' Acrobat President Roland Klassen said. 'We considered a number of communities, but the available site in Calais is perfect, and development leaders have been excellent in answering our questions.'

It is expected that the company will occupy the former ICT Group telemarketing call centre, which closed four years ago.

The firm was founded in 1994 and provides opinion polls, customer satisfaction and advertising awareness surveys. Home page: www.acrobatresearch.com.
